mournfully

adv.
1.in a mournful manner

    eat in
    to eat at home, to eat in a restaurant where you have a choice to either eat in the restaurant or take the food out
    We usually like to eat in on the weekends. We went to the fast food restaurant and we decided to eat in rather than take the food out.
